Lines Matching refs:srcu_cblist
136 rcu_segcblist_init(&sdp->srcu_cblist); in init_srcu_struct_nodes()
384 if (WARN_ON(rcu_segcblist_n_cbs(&sdp->srcu_cblist))) in cleanup_srcu_struct()
446 rcu_segcblist_advance(&sdp->srcu_cblist, in srcu_gp_start()
448 (void)rcu_segcblist_accelerate(&sdp->srcu_cblist, in srcu_gp_start()
769 if (rcu_segcblist_pend_cbs(&sdp->srcu_cblist)) { in srcu_might_be_idle()
856 rcu_segcblist_enqueue(&sdp->srcu_cblist, rhp, false); in __call_srcu()
857 rcu_segcblist_advance(&sdp->srcu_cblist, in __call_srcu()
860 (void)rcu_segcblist_accelerate(&sdp->srcu_cblist, s); in __call_srcu()
1054 if (!rcu_segcblist_entrain(&sdp->srcu_cblist, in srcu_barrier()
1169 rcu_segcblist_advance(&sdp->srcu_cblist, in srcu_invoke_callbacks()
1172 !rcu_segcblist_ready_cbs(&sdp->srcu_cblist)) { in srcu_invoke_callbacks()
1179 rcu_segcblist_extract_done_cbs(&sdp->srcu_cblist, &ready_cbs); in srcu_invoke_callbacks()
1194 rcu_segcblist_insert_count(&sdp->srcu_cblist, &ready_cbs); in srcu_invoke_callbacks()
1195 (void)rcu_segcblist_accelerate(&sdp->srcu_cblist, in srcu_invoke_callbacks()
1198 more = rcu_segcblist_ready_cbs(&sdp->srcu_cblist); in srcu_invoke_callbacks()
1284 "C."[rcu_segcblist_empty(&sdp->srcu_cblist)]); in srcu_torture_stats_print()